The healthcare industry produces a significant amount of waste on a daily basis, including hazardous materials that require special handling and disposal. The proper management of hospital waste is crucial in order to protect public health and the environment. One method that has been used for many years to manage hospital waste is through the use of incinerators.
incinerator hospital waste management involves the burning of medical waste at high temperatures until it is reduced to ash. This process helps to destroy harmful pathogens and reduce the volume of waste that needs to be disposed of in landfills. Incinerators are equipped with pollution control devices that help to minimize the release of harmful emissions into the atmosphere.
One of the key benefits of using incinerators for hospital waste management is that it allows for the safe disposal of infectious waste, such as used syringes, bandages, and other items that may be contaminated with blood or bodily fluids. By incinerating these materials, the risk of spreading infections and diseases is greatly reduced. In addition, the ash that is produced by the incineration process is sterile and can be safely disposed of in landfills.
Another advantage of using incinerators for hospital waste management is that it helps to reduce the volume of waste that needs to be transported and disposed of. Incinerators can process large quantities of waste in a relatively short amount of time, which can help to lower the overall cost of waste management for healthcare facilities. This can be especially important for hospitals that generate a high volume of waste on a daily basis.
In addition to the environmental benefits of using incinerators for hospital waste management, there are also economic benefits. By reducing the volume of waste that needs to be disposed of in landfills, hospitals can save on disposal costs and reduce the strain on local waste management facilities. Incinerators can also generate energy in the form of heat, which can be used to reduce the reliance on fossil fuels and lower energy costs for hospitals.
While incinerator hospital waste management has many benefits, there are also some challenges and concerns associated with this method. One major concern is the potential release of harmful emissions into the atmosphere during the incineration process. To address this issue, modern incinerators are equipped with advanced pollution control devices, such as scrubbers and filters, that help to capture and remove pollutants before they are released into the air.
Another concern with using incinerators for hospital waste management is the potential for the release of toxic substances, such as dioxins and heavy metals, into the environment. To mitigate this risk, incinerators must be operated and maintained in accordance with strict regulations and guidelines. Regular monitoring and testing of emissions are also essential to ensure that incinerators are operating safely and in compliance with environmental standards.
